Can a general practitioner issue a prescription for medical marijuana as part of the teleadvice available on the website?

"Through teleconsultation, you will not receive a referral for X-ray and tomography, nor a prescription for psychotropic drugs with a similar effect, or some reimbursed drugs that require access to a medical history." Such information appears on our website. Prescribing medical marijuana requires access to medical history, so it seems to me that you will not get such a prescription through teleadvice. Is there a maximum number of prescriptions that can be issued by a doctor within one teleadvice? There is no specific, imposed number - it all depends on the doctor and the course of teleadvice.

If your doctor determines that the medical records he or she obtains from you are sufficient to issue a prescription for medical marijuana, he or she can do so. In order for a doctor to be able to issue a prescription for medical marijuana to a patient, he must have a special print marked with the Symbol Rpw., which is reserved for narcotic drugs (the doctor may not have such a print, however). Medical cannabis and the drugs made from it are narcotic and psychoactive drugs - their turnover is strictly controlled. The decision to write it is invariably made by the doctor, so if he decides that further diagnostics are necessary and a visit to the attending physician (leading) may refuse to issue such a prescription - it is not his duty. A doctor prescribing medical marijuana should be guided by current scientific reports and not go beyond the scope of his skills and competences.
